Animal Production is based in Irene, with several satellite stations strategically positioned throughout the country. This research focus area carries out primary and secondary research, development and technology transfer with respect to Animal Breeding and Improvement, Rangelands and Nutrition, and Food Science and Technology to improve productivity and sustainable resource utilisation. In addition, this research focus area serves as the custodian of national assets such as the conservation of animal, forage and bacterial culture collection genetic resources, including databases and DNA banks associated with them. ? The country's Livestock Recording and Improvement Schemes and associated database, the Integrated Registration and Genetic Information System (INTERGIS) are also managed by this division on behalf of the Department of Agriculture, Forestry and Fisheries. Animal Production's strategic focus for research and service delivery is guided by the strategic goals of the ARC

The Role of Agricultural Engineering: The core purpose of this division is to develop and apply agricultural engineering technology that will contribute to higher yields, higher income and lower input costs for agriculture and related industries in a sustainable way. The objectives are thus: •To create wealth and to eliminate poverty in agriculture by increasing profits through the reduction of input costs, increased production, improved product quality, and value adding. •To develop and apply engineering technology for the sustainable utilisation and development of resources used in agriculture. •To promote and increase the efficient and sustainable utilisation of natural resources. •To protect, reclaim and restore deteriorated natural resources. •To develop human resources in the field of agricultural engineering technology.

The ARC-Onderstepoort Veterinary Research Campus (ARC-OVR), has long tradition of veterinary research since its founding in 1908 by Sir Arnold Theiler It is nationally and internationally recognized as a veterinary centre of excellence. The ARC-OVR is a flagship Campus of the Agricultural Research Council and plays an important role in maintaining the health of our national herd and wildlife.

The ARC-Institute for Industrial Crops is an Institute of the Agricultural Research Council in South Africa. ARC-IIC is responsible for all the research on cotton, hemp, flax, kenaf, sisal, tobacco and indigenous fibre crops. The Institute, based in Rustenburg in the North West Province, operates with three research divisions namely, Plant Protection, Crop and Soil Science and Cultivar Development. The Institute also manages three experimental stations and conducts field trials in all the production areas for cotton, tobacco and the other crops mentioned above in South Africa.
